Overview: The Network Control Operator (any industry) job description template includes the following job summary: 1)Monitors data communications network to ensure that network is available to all system users and resolves data communications problems; Receives telephone call from user with data communications problem, such as failure of data to be transmitted to another location. Reviews procedures user followed to determine if specified steps were taken; Explains user procedures necessary to transmit data; Monitors modems and display screen of terminal to mainframe computer to detect error messages that signal malfunction in communications software or hardware; Enters diagnostic commands into computer to determine nature of problem, and reads codes on screen to diagnose problem. Additional information available includes essential job functions, additional responsibilities, and education and experience requirements.
